From the Manila Times:

United Opposition (Uno) president and Makati Mayor Jejomar Binay on Thursday unveiled a new signature drive by the Arroyo administration to amend the Constitution.

Mayor Binay said that the Interior Secretary Ronaldo Puno was heading operations for the “rehashed” people’s initiative.

The new twist, Binay said, is the push for a unicameral legislature under a presidential system—a move that sidelines Speaker Jose de Venecia’s dream for a parliamentary form of government.

“The organization is there, and they are ready to move. It will involve local officials and DILG personnel,” said Binay.

Contrary to administration claims of a possible plebiscite in tandem with the May 2007 polls, Binay said the new game plan eyes a plebiscite in February.
